Population & Demographics

The following information lists the population statistics and breakdown for the 65332 zip code. The total population is 1525, of which, 819 are male and 706 are female. With a total area of 230.149 square miles, the population density is 6.7 people per square mile. The median age of the population is 48.3 years old. Income & Economic Characteristics

The median inflation-adjusted family income in the 65332 zip code is $65417. This is -13.10% less than the national average. This income places 6.7% of the population below the poverty line. The average retirement income for individuals in this zip code (for those that have it) is $24240. Education

In the 65332 zip code, 96% of individuals over 25 years old have a high school degree or higher, and 14.2% have a bachelors degree or higher. Occupation and Work Characteristics

In the 65332 zip, there are an estimated 737 people in the labor force, of which, 719 are employed, and 14 are unemployed. There are a total of 4 people in the armed forces. The average commute time for this zip code is 25.4 minutes. Of the total people that work, 39 worked from home and 707 commuted. The average number of hours worked is 38.5. Housing

The median home value for the 65332 zip code is 148900. There is an estimated  595 number of occupied housing units, the median gross rent in is $578 per month, and the average monthly housing costs are estimated to be $757.
